The Community Foundation's Give for Good

Give for Good is an annual online giving event organized by The Community Foundation of North Louisiana. This 24-hour event encourages individuals to donate to their favorite non-profit organizations and charities in Northwest Louisiana.

The first Give for Good event was held in 2014, and since then, it has raised over $15 million for various organizations. The success of Give for Good can be attributed to its user-friendly online platform, which makes it easy for individuals to donate to multiple organizations in one go. The event also creates a sense of urgency and excitement, with a live leaderboard showcasing the top organizations and their fundraising progress. Additionally, The Community Foundation provides training and resources to participating organizations to help them maximize their fundraising potential.

The Food Bank of Northwest Louisiana's Empty Bowls

Empty Bowls is an annual fundraising event organized by The Food Bank of Northwest Louisiana. This event brings together local artists, restaurants, and community members to raise funds and awareness for hunger in the region.

The highlight of the event is a soup lunch where attendees can purchase a handcrafted bowl and enjoy a meal together. Empty Bowls has been a huge success, raising over $1 million since its inception in 2005. The event's success can be attributed to its unique concept, which combines art, food, and philanthropy. It also creates a sense of community and brings people together for a common cause.

The United Way of Northwest Louisiana's Red River Revel

The Red River Revel is an annual arts festival organized by The United Way of Northwest Louisiana. This week-long event features live music, food vendors, and various activities for all ages. The festival also serves as a fundraiser for The United Way, with proceeds going towards supporting their partner agencies. The Red River Revel has been a staple event in Northwest Louisiana since 1976 and has raised over $10 million for The United Way.

Its success can be attributed to its diverse range of activities that appeal to a wide audience. It also provides an opportunity for local artists and businesses to showcase their talents and products while supporting a good cause.

The Key Factors for Successful Fundraising Campaigns

After analyzing these successful fundraising campaigns, I have identified some key factors that contribute to their success. These include:
  • Engaging and Unique Concept: Successful fundraising campaigns often have a unique and engaging concept that sets them apart from others. This helps to capture people's attention and create a buzz around the event.
  • Community Involvement: Involving the community in the fundraising process is crucial for its success.

    This creates a sense of ownership and encourages individuals to contribute towards a cause that directly impacts their community.

  • Effective Marketing and Promotion: A well-planned marketing and promotion strategy is essential for reaching a wider audience and generating interest in the event. This can include social media campaigns, partnerships with local businesses, and traditional advertising methods.
  • Transparency and Accountability: Donors want to know where their money is going and how it is being used. Successful fundraising campaigns are transparent about their finances and provide regular updates on the impact of their donations.
